This Letter of Commitment is based upon our review of the corrective action costs <br /> incurred to date and your application received on January 17, 1992 and may be modified by the State Board in writing by <br /> an amended Letter of Commitment. <br /> The State Board will take steps to withdraw this Letter of Commitment after 90 calendar days from the date of this <br /> transmittal letter unless you proceed with due diligence with your cleanup effort. This means that you must take positive, <br /> concrete steps to ensure that corrective action is proceeding with all due speed. For example, if you have not started your <br /> cleanup effort, you must obtain three bids and sign a contract with one of these bidders within 90 calendar days. If your <br /> cleanup effort has already started and was delayed, you must resume the expenditure of funds to ensure that your cleanup <br /> is proceeding in an expeditious manner. You are reminded that you must comply with all regulatory agency time schedules <br /> and requirements. We constantly review the. status of all active claims, and failure to proceed with due diligence will be <br /> grounds for withdrawal of this Letter of Commitment. <br /> You should read the terms and conditions listed in the Letter of Commitment.
